Course Overview:
This 10-day training course, offered by IRES Company, is tailored to provide a comprehensive understanding of actuarial modeling and regulatory software. Participants will be trained in the use of advanced software tools such as Milliman's MG-ALFA, Moody’s Analytics, or ProVal to develop actuarial models, conduct risk assessments, and ensure regulatory compliance. The course blends theoretical knowledge with hands-on practice, including real-life projects and case studies, to equip attendees with the skills needed to efficiently manage actuarial data and adhere to industry regulations.

Course Modules
Course Outline:
Module 1: Introduction to Actuarial Modeling Software
- Overview of actuarial modeling software functionalities
- Key features for building and analyzing actuarial models
- User interface and navigation
- Case Study: Developing a basic actuarial model for insurance products
Module 2: Advanced Actuarial Modeling Techniques
- Complex actuarial modeling methods
- Handling large datasets and complex calculations
- Scenario analysis and stress testing
- Real-Life Project: Creating a detailed actuarial model for a pension scheme
Module 3: Regulatory Requirements and Compliance
- Overview of regulatory requirements for actuarial practices
- Using software tools to ensure compliance
- Generating regulatory compliance reports
- Case Study: Preparing a compliance report for a regulatory review
Module 4: Data Management and Integration
- Importing and managing actuarial data
- Data integration with other financial systems
- Ensuring data accuracy and integrity
- Real-Life Project: Integrating actuarial data with financial reporting systems
Module 5: Risk Assessment and Management
- Utilizing software tools for risk assessment
- Analyzing risk factors and impact on actuarial models
- Developing risk management strategies
- Case Study: Conducting a risk assessment for a new actuarial model
Module 6: Reporting and Documentation
- Generating standard and custom reports
- Documenting actuarial models and compliance processes
- Communicating findings to stakeholders
- Real-Life Project: Creating a comprehensive report on actuarial model results
Module 7: Software Customization and Advanced Features
- Customizing software tools for specific actuarial needs
- Exploring advanced features and functionalities
- Troubleshooting common issues
- Case Study: Customizing software for a unique actuarial project
Module 8: Scenario Modeling and Forecasting
- Building scenario models to project future outcomes
- Analyzing different forecasting methods
- Applying scenario modeling to decision-making
- Real-Life Project: Developing and analyzing scenario forecasts for a pension fund
Module 9: Compliance and Audit Trails
- Ensuring software compliance with industry standards
- Maintaining audit trails and tracking changes
- Preparing for software audits and reviews
- Case Study: Conducting an audit of actuarial models and compliance records
Module 10: Future Trends and Innovations
- Emerging trends in actuarial modeling and regulatory software
- Integrating new technologies and methodologies
- Preparing for future changes in regulatory requirements
- Real-Life Project: Evaluating and implementing innovative features in actuarial software
